1. Parties: Identifies and provides full legal details of the licensor and licensee
2. Background: Explains the context of the agreement and the parties' intentions
3. Definitions: Defines key terms used throughout the agreement
4. Grant of License: Specifies the exact rights being granted, including scope, territory, and exclusivity
5. Term and Termination: Details the duration of the license and circumstances for termination
6. License Fees: Outlines the payment terms, amounts, and payment schedule
7. Use of Licensed Property: Specifies permitted uses and restrictions on the licensed property
8. Intellectual Property Rights: Confirms ownership and protection of intellectual property
9. Warranties and Representations: States the parties' warranties regarding the license and licensed property
10. Liability and Indemnification: Sets out liability limitations and indemnification obligations
11. General Provisions: Contains standard boilerplate clauses including governing law, notices, and assignment
1. Quality Control: Required when the license involves branding or quality standards that must be maintained
2. Sublicensing Rights: Include when sublicensing is permitted or specifically prohibited
3. Reporting Requirements: Used when licensee must provide regular reports on usage or sales
4. Improvement Rights: Necessary when dealing with technology licenses where improvements may be developed
5. Export Control: Include when licensed property may be subject to export restrictions
6. Source Code Escrow: Required for software licenses where source code protection is needed
7. Training and Support: Include when the license includes ongoing support or training obligations
1. Schedule 1 - Licensed Property: Detailed description of the property being licensed, including technical specifications
2. Schedule 2 - Fee Schedule: Detailed breakdown of all fees, royalties, and payment terms
3. Schedule 3 - Technical Requirements: Technical specifications or requirements for using the licensed property
4. Schedule 4 - Service Levels: Performance standards and service levels if applicable
5. Appendix A - Approved Use Examples: Examples of approved uses of the licensed property
6. Appendix B - Territory Map: If territorial restrictions apply, defines the geographic boundaries
